Atwell is a national consulting, engineering, land development, and construction management firm headquartered in Southfield, Michigan. Founded in 1905, the private equity-backed enterprise operates in partnership with global investment firm Advent International alongside President & CEO Matthew C. Bissett.

Job Description

Atwell is seeking a Land Solutions Project Manager to support a leading electric transmission client across a portfolio of high-voltage infrastructure and right of way (ROW) projects throughout the Midwest, with a primary focus in the St. Louis, Missouri region.

This role is remote, but candidates located in or near St. Louis are strongly preferred due to the need for frequent in-person client engagement, stakeholder meetings, and site visits. This is a highly visible, client-facing role where your ability to build trust and represent Atwell locally will directly impact project success.

In this role, you will oversee land and ROW acquisition activities supporting electric transmission infrastructure - managing easement negotiations, rights of entry, surface agreements, damage settlements, and fee property transactions across active transmission corridors.

You’ll establish project scope, budgets, and schedules; manage contracts and sub-consultants; and ensure performance metrics are met throughout the project lifecycle.

You’ll also serve as a trusted advisor to the client, maintaining a consistent presence in the region, staying ahead of their project pipeline, following up on outstanding proposals, and identifying opportunities to expand Atwell’s support. Internally, you’ll manage project documentation in Vision, oversee invoicing and collections, and deliver regular financial and progress reporting to leadership. Coaching and mentoring your project team is a key part of how you operate.
